GEO 101: getting cited by ChatGPT & Gemini

Generative Engine Optimization explained — how to structure content so AI answer engines cite you as the source.

Search is splitting in two

People increasingly ask ChatGPT, Gemini and Perplexity instead of scrolling ten blue links. GEO is the practice of making your content the answer these engines quote.

Structure for machines and humans

Use semantic HTML, clear headings, and Schema.org markup (Organization, Service, FAQPage). Add concise, self-contained “knowledge blocks” that an LLM can lift and cite without ambiguity.

Own your entities

Be consistent about who you are, what you do and where, across your site and the web. Strong, consistent entity signals make engines confident enough to cite you.

Measure AI visibility

Track when and how AI engines mention your brand, and which questions trigger citations. Then expand the content that earns them.
